API de Integración Dotear
Documentación oficial para conectar sistemas externos y automatizar la gestión de productos, clientes, compras y redenciones en tu programa de fidelización.
Autenticación
Todos los endpoints requieren API Key. Inclúyela en el header
Authorization: Bearer TU_API_KEY
o x-api-key: TU_API_KEY
.Endpoints principales
Negocio
- GET /api/integration/business Obtener información y estadísticas del negocio
Productos
- GET /api/integration/products Listar productos
- POST /api/integration/products Crear producto (soporta imagen)
- PUT /api/integration/products Actualizar producto (soporta imagen)
- DELETE /api/integration/products?id=PRODUCT_ID Eliminar producto
Clientes
- GET /api/integration/customers Listar clientes del negocio
- POST /api/integration/customers Registrar cliente
Compras
- GET /api/integration/purchases Listar compras del negocio
- POST /api/integration/purchases Registrar compra
Redenciones
- GET /api/integration/redemptions Listar redenciones del negocio
- POST /api/integration/redemptions Registrar redención de puntos
Ejemplo de uso
Terminal
$ curl -X GET "https://dotear.com/api/integration/business" -H "Authorization: Bearer TU_API_KEY" -i
Cambia TU_API_KEY
por tu valor real.
Respuestas y errores
- 204 No Content: Eliminación exitosa
- 401 Unauthorized: API Key inválida o ausente
- 404 Not Found: Recurso no encontrado o no pertenece al negocio
- 400 Bad Request: Parámetros requeridos faltantes
- 500 Internal Server Error: Error inesperado
Soporte
¿Dudas o problemas? Contáctanos en info@dotear.com